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4295039389 597900060 78983 79
96063625 9990
96063625 9990
62497 31 6217
All about undefined
Interested in learning more?
96063625 9990
62497 31 6217
See more
5107839 75568614
551904667 1068 2529881085 7891807983
See more
7583610 130152749 13615211885
84676594366 0327059 43 9883150539
See more